全栈开发技术体系解析
作为通用型脚本语言的代表,Python以语法简洁、学习曲线平缓著称。达内教育研发的课程体系,融合爬虫数据采集、商业智能分析、智能算法应用三大技术方向,构建完整的能力培养路径。
| 技术方向 | 核心能力培养 | 项目案例 |
|---|---|---|
| 网络数据采集 | 动态页面解析、反爬策略应对 | 电商价格监控系统 |
| 数据分析挖掘 | NumPy/Pandas数据建模 | 城市交通流量预测 |
| 机器学习应用 | 监督学习模型构建 | 用户行为分析系统 |
核心技术模块详解
数据采集与清洗技术
掌握Scrapy框架的分布式部署方案,通过模拟浏览器行为突破动态加载限制。学习XPath与正则表达式组合应用,实现复杂数据结构提取。典型案例包括新闻聚合平台搭建、舆情监控系统开发。
商业智能分析实践
运用Matplotlib构建交互式数据看板,通过Seaborn实现多维数据可视化。结合Pandas进行时间序列分析,完成销售预测模型的建立与优化。项目涉及零售业库存预警系统开发、金融行业风险评估模型构建。
教学服务体系创新
- ▶ 每日代码审查:助教实时跟踪Git提交记录
- ▶ 项目答辩机制:每周进行阶段性成果展示
- ▶ 缺陷跟踪系统:记录并分析编码过程中的典型问题
企业级项目实战
课程包含完整的项目开发周期模拟,从需求分析会议到UAT测试验收,学员将经历:
- 原型设计工具使用(Axure/Mockplus)
- 版本控制系统实战(Git Flow工作流)
- 持续集成环境搭建(Jenkins+Docker)
技术能力提升路径
通过四阶段能力跃迁计划:
- √ 语法基础强化训练
- √ 标准库深度解析
- √ 设计模式实践
- √ 性能优化专题
